Dive into the mythical world of mermaids and other deep-sea spirits in this gorgeously illustrated guidebook.

For centuries, mermaids have fascinated the public imagination, representing the mysteries of the ocean. Mermaids offers you a detailed exploration of the myths and legends of these deep-sea creatures in a beautiful package. Through rich historical detail and original artwork, uncover the lore of mermaids and other sea creatures across the world, including:

  • The Origins of Mermaids
  • Mermaids in Ancient cultures
  • European Mermaid Lore
  • African and Polynesian Mermaids
  • Mermaid-Related Symbols and Meanings
  • And more!

Featuring a comprehensive appendix of mermaid sites around the world, Mermaids offers a deep dive into mermaid research and tales of close encounters with these sirens of the deep. Perfect for mermaid lovers and fans of mythology, Mermaids is your chance to discover how these creatures have captivated and influenced human culture around the globe. 

The Folklore Legends series summons the mythical, magical, and mysterious creatures of lore out of the shadows with in-depth explorations of their stories and histories. Featuring original, woodcut illustrations and tales both famous and forgotten, these display-worthy volumes reveal the common traits, cultural variations, and appearances of these legendary beings across time and around the world.

The series includes: Witchcraft, Vampires, Werewolves, and Dragons.
